    Constructed with stainless steel type SS316 for enduring internal and external corrosion, Pedlock stainless steel needle valves meet the needs of all fluid flow applications and come with full and reduced bore options.


    Technical Performance Matrix

    System Parameter Manufacturing Specification
    Body Construction Material Stainless Steel (SS 316), Carbon Steel (CS), Bar Stock & Forged Steel
    Standard Operating Pressure 6,000 PSI (431 bar) / 400 kg/cm²
    Extended High-Pressure Range Up to 15,000 PSI and 20,000 PSI variants
    Temperature Tolerance Up to 250ºF
    Sealing Components O-ring seals available in Nitrile & Viton
    Internal Seat Design Performance PEEK / Delrin seating with hard chrome-plated stem/ball
    Sizing Range (Tube/Port) 1/4” to 3”
    Thread Connection Types Threaded (NPT, BSPT, BSPP - Male / Female)
    Seat & Seal Leakage Rate Tested up to 0.1 std. cm³/min maximum limit
    Hydrostatic Testing Benchmark Pure water tested at 1-1/2 times working pressure
    Standard Inclusions Burnished thread-rolled spindle, low torque design, protective dust caps

    Key Structural Highlights:

  • Burnished Thread-Rolled Spindle : Stops the galling affecting the threads of the stem and offers long-lasting wear resistance while allowing the handwheel to operate smoothly.
  • Low Operating Torque : Bases provide easy throttle operation manually even in the conditions of high pressure.
  • Space-Saving Compact Footprint : Suitable size enables the application of the device even in control cabinets and multi-valve manifolds that lack space.
  • Protective Dust & Thread Caps : Factory-installed caps protect the threads and internal components from dust and dirt during shipping and storing process.
  • Where and How Are Ped-Lock Needle Valves Integrated Across Industrial Sectors?

    Needle valves for instruments serve a critical purpose as safety and measurement barriers when installed upstream from pressure transmitters, testing loops, sampling points, and process meters. They enable technicians to isolate their instruments without having to shut off the main line.


    Industry Application & Use Case Guide

    Industry / Application Integration Context System Utility & Advantages
    Chemical Processing Acid/alkali dosing lines, chemical injection skids, sampling ports SS 316 alloy resists chemical attack and guarantees zero external leakage.
    Fats & Fertilizer Plants High-pressure ammonia lines, raw material blending, slurry lines Ensures precise flow metering and tight shut-off under continuous thermal/pressure stress.
    Shipbuilding & Marine Marine engine hydraulics, fuel oil regulation, panel gauge isolation Compact, vibration-resistant build ensures steady operation in marine environments.
    Construction & Hydraulics Concrete pumping machinery, heavy-duty hydraulic lines, fluid power units Forged body easily withstands intense pressure cycles up to 6,000+ PSI.
    Calibration & Testing Labs Test benches, gas manifolds, pressure calibration rigs Enables micro-metering of liquid and gas media without pressure drop.

    What Hazards and Drawbacks Arise When Systems Lack Instrument Needle Valves?

    The use of ordinary utility valves instead of specialized instrument needle valves for high-pressure lines can lead to significant risks in the operations:

  • Loss of Fine Flow Regulation : Regular gate or ball valves are strictly for on and off purposes. The also try to control flow using that kind of system can cause turbulence, unpredictable fluctuations in pressure and failure in fluid process control.
  • Elevated Leakage and Safety Risks : Generic valves might fail and leak at extreme working pressures ranging from 6000 to 20000 psi, causing chemical spillages and environmental damage and putting people in danger.
  • Damage to Costly Gauges & Sensors : In the absence of needle valves that can handle sudden pressure fluctuations, sensitive measuring pressure instruments like gauges, transmitters, and sensors experience fluid shock and instant breakdown.
  • Frequent Component Wear and Downtime : Inferior valves’ stems deteriorate at an alarming speed since they endure high levels of friction, which leads to leaks, expensive downtime, and lots of repair expenses.
  • Quality Non-Compliance : Unqualified fluid lines fail hydro-testing and quality verification process and jeopardize the entire plant’s safety compliance.
